She's a plain Jane. He's uber famous. Who's stalking who?

Author Sally Speck has it all-a promising career, great friends, a loving family. So when superstar celebrity Tom Darlington takes an interest in her, she thinks, why not?

But the fun fling soon turns into a nightmare, as she's relentlessly hounded by the media and harassed by Tom's crazed fans. But more worrying is Tom's increasingly obsessive and frightening behavior.

As Sally's life crumbles around her, she learns a shocking family secret that threatens to tip her over the edge. Perhaps drastic action is her only hope of escape....

What happens when a celebrity stalks a fan? Find out in this gripping psychological thriller about dark obsessions, family bonds spiraling out of control, and just how far we'll go when pushed past our limits.
